A male, Eastern towhee (Pipilo erythrophthalmus), is a striking bird of white, brown and black colors. It is a large bird for the sparrow kingdom, with a length around 8 inches and a wingspan of 11 inches. As its name implies, it's more common in the eastern U.S.
